Block

#18,577,260
Block Number
18,577,260 @ 2024-05-21 22:07:20
Status
Finalized
ID
0x011b776c4e9cc13b1e218ba70992672542119135b70f41800d6d96c7e0fa9ef9
Transactions
Gas Used
21000/40000000 (0.05% Used)
Total Score
1,810,517,026 (+96)
Rewards
0.06 VTHO